Connect your Bluehost domain to Kartra and create branded links for a professional look.
A custom domain (like www.yourdomain.com) makes your online presence professional. When you connect your domain to Kartra, you can use branded links and show your visitors a consistent brand. In this guide, you will learn how to set up your Bluehost domain so that it works well with Kartra.
To do this, follow these four steps:
- Set up domain forwarding
- Only for www. domains. Skip this step if you’re connecting a subdomain—e.g. subdomain.yourdomain.com.
- Create a CNAME record in Bluehost.
- Link your domain to Kartra (may take up to 24 hours to process).
- Customize your URLs in Kartra.
Before you begin...
Review these guides:
They’ll give you helpful context and make the steps ahead much easier to follow—plus, they’ll help you avoid common setup issues.
Key Details:
- Terminology note: Forwarding is referred to as "Redirect" in Bluehost.
- Legacy: Older Bluehost accounts have vaguely different steps to reach the Zone Editor. Please see the details in the official setup guides linked below.
Step 1: Forwarding rule setup
Domain forwarding sends visitors from your primary address to the secure www version of your site. This helps avoid confusion if users type your domain in different ways. Skip this step if you are integrating a subdomain.
- Access Domains in your Bluehost cPanel account.
- Go to the Redirecttab to add a redirect.
- Type: Permanent 301
- URL to redirect: your domain name
- Redirects to: https://www.yourdomain.com (replace www.yourdomain.com with your actual domain)
- WWW Redirect: Redirect with or without www.
- Click Add to save the rule.
Step 2: Add the CNAME record
A CNAME record tells browsers where to find your site. This step ensures that when someone visits your branded URL, they’re taken directly to your Kartra-hosted content.
- Access the Zone Editor in your Bluehost account.
- Add the following details to create the record:
- Type: CNAME
- Host Record: www
- Points to: YourUsername.kartra.com (replace “YourUsername” with your Kartra account username)
- TTL: default
- Click Add Record to save.
Official Bluehost Setup Guides
After completing steps 1 and 2 at Bluehost, go back to Kartra for steps 3 and 4.
Step 3: Link your domain to Kartra
To do this:
- Go to Settings > Domains and click + Custom domain.
- Choose if you’re adding Only the main domain (www.) or Use a sub-domain.
- Pro-tip: If you already have a published site you want to keep associated with your main domain, a subdomain would better suit your needs.
- Insert the domain or subdomain and a favicon and click Next.
- Tick the box to acknowledge Yes, I have completed the steps above to link my custom domain to Kartra in my domain service provider’s account and click Next in upper right.
- Set up your Index (home) and 404 error pages and click Next in the upper right.
Do not input the domain you are connecting to Kartra as the external URL option for the index page. This will create an endless loop.
It can take up to 24 hours for a domain integration to be connected. You will see a Processing… status next to your domain name until the connection is complete.
The Connected status shows the domain integration was successful.
After the domain connects to your Kartra account, you can use it to brand your Kartra asset URLs.
Step 4: Brand your page links in Kartra
Asset links in Kartra must be edited individually. To edit a page link and brand it with your domain:
- Go to Pages > All Pages.
- Click the link icon button under a published page’s thumbnail.
- Choose Get the page link, and click the pencil icon button to edit.
- Expand the dropdown, and select your domain.
- (Optional) In the next field, you can customize the name of the page as shown in the link (in this example, “opt-in”)
- Click the checkmark icon button to save the changes, and Close the link editing wizard.
Now you can access the page using the URL you configured.